- The distance between Putao, Myanmar and Claremorris, Ireland is approximately 8,583 km or 5,334 mi.
- To reach Putao in this distance one would set out from Claremorris bearing 60.9°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Putao bearing 144.4° or SE .
- Putao has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a) whereas Claremorris has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Putao is in or near the warm temperate wet forest biome whereas Claremorris is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The average temperature is 11.7 °C (21.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3 °C (5.4°F) more in Putao.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2858 mm (112.5 in) more which is equivalent to 2858 l/m² (70.14 US gal/ft²) or 28,580,000 l/ha (3,055,392 US gal/ac) more. About 3 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26.3° higher in Putao than in Claremorris.
